PICKING SOCCER ALL-BLACKS

NORTH v. SOUTH TEAMS. WELLINGTON, April 12. The following teams have been selected to play in the North v. South game at the Basin Reserve, Wellington, on Saturday:— North Island: Quill (Auckland), Stone and St. Gerrard (Auckland), McLeod (Wellington), Christie (Auckland) captain, Crabbe ’ (South Auckland), Barton, Condon, Leslie, Kershaw (Wellington), Kay (Auckland). South Island: Timkin (Westland) captain, S. Cawtheray (Canterbury), H. Cope (Otago), J. Terchart (Buller), A. Sutherland (Canterbury), W. Chapman (Otago), C. Ives (Otago), D. Sutherland (Canterbury), A. Trotter (Canterbury), G. Groves (Otago), D. Q. Walker (Canterbury). Reserves: S. Taylor, A. Brown, Stenhouso (Otago), A. Graham (Buller). The reserves in each case will replace other players in the second half of the game.
